Description:This handsomely illustrated book presents many fascinating insights into the diverse landscape and culture of Scotland, including: Islands and coasts with their rich bird populations. Remote and rugged Highland landscapes. Majestic wildlife. Vibrant modern cities such as Edinburgh and Glasgow. Exciting architecture, both old and new cultural traditions that link past and present ... and more! Scotland will enchant readers with the splendor and contrasts of this captivating country.BiographyJessica Renison is half Scottish Campbell on her mother's side and proud of it. She enjoyed many a childhood vacation in Scotland, roaming the gnat-infested glens and swimming in the freezing cold lochs. Chiefly a writer of fiction, Jessica has written countless short stories and is currently at work on a historical novel. Her nonfiction works include the hugely popular children's series The Secret History of Dragons / Fairies / Unicorns.
